Add generic CLI commands to turn device lights on and off.
These will call out to orchestrator stubs, once it has the appropriate hook
implemented, which will in turn call out to salt or rook or ssh or whatever
to actually turn a light on or off.

Somehow the compression mode "unset" was shown, but "unset" is only the
key that should be send to the backend in order to know that not
compression mode is selected ("none").
I also added some comments for better understanding.

This commit implements several new features:
* a --cherry-pick-only option
* a --force option
* an --existing-pr option
* an interactive setup routine
The --cherry-pick-only option can be used to test whether a backport
cherry-picks cleanly, for example. This is the same as the --prepare
functionality that was provided by an earlier version of the script, and
--prepare is re-introduced as a synonym for --cherry-pick-only.
The --force option can be used to make the script less careful (less
"cowardly"). For example, if the script refuses to do a backport because the
backport tracker issue is assigned to someone else, the script will "cowardly"
refuse to continue. Use --force to override. Be aware that --force will also
blow away an existing wip branch - the script asks for user confirmation in this
case.
The new --existing-pr option can be used to specify the number (ID) of an
existing backport PR that addresses the backport tracker issue given via the
positional argument.
The new "interactive setup routine" should make the setup process much simpler
for the user. If there is a setup issue, the script produces a report and starts
the interactive setup routine, which prompts the user for the needed
information.
Also, the script no longer requires the user to explicitly provide values for
github_user and redmine_user_id. Instead, it divines the correct values from the
GitHub token and the Redmine key, respectively.
Finally, the existing ~/bin/backport_common.sh file is deprecated in favor of
two files:
~/.github_token
~/.redmine_key
(The latter is already used by Sage's build-integration-branch tool and it
didn't make sense to have two different configuration files for a single
purpose.)
